7‑Day Playbook: How to Hire Faster at Your Auto Dealership

A close-up of a car tire in motion, showing a vehicle speeding down a street with motion blur to emphasize speed.

If you run a dealership today, you already feel hiring pain points: candidates have options, expectations are higher than ever, and the best people move fast. In this environment, speed isn’t a “nice to have”—it’s the difference between fully staffed lanes and empty bays. The good news is that moving faster doesn’t mean lowering the bar; it means building a hiring process that respects candidates’ time, removes friction, and communicates decisiveness.

Why Speed Matters Now

Candidates expect action in days, not weeks.

Hireology’s 2025 applicant research found more than half of auto applicants expect to be invited to an interview within just four days of applying. The clock starts the moment their application hits your inbox. If you’re not moving that quickly, you’re losing them to dealers who are ready to respond, schedule, and follow through—with many candidates interpreting silence as a “no.”

They’re shopping around—aggressively.

Thirty-eight percent of job seekers apply to 30+ jobs in six months, and only 36% accept the first offer they receive, while 46% decline it. In other words, you’re competing on experience and velocity as much as pay; the dealer that engages early, communicates clearly, and simplifies next steps often wins the tie.

Friction kills great pipelines.

Forty-six percent have skipped applying because they had to create an account. If your hiring process isn’t mobile-first and frictionless, you’re invisibly turning away talent before they’ve even had a chance to impress you—especially those who are already employed and applying between customers, on lunch breaks, or from the service lounge.

5 Steps to Make Speed Your Hiring Advantage 

1. Set and Enforce Speed Guidelines

Consider leveraging simple, non-negotiable targets that keep everyone aligned: same-day resume review and 24-hour first-touch for all new applicants, with interview invitations sent within 2–4 days of application to meet market expectations. Pair those targets with automated interview scheduling to eliminate back-and-forth and preserve momentum from the first “hello” to the final offer.

2. Remove application friction

Eliminate account creation and cut nonessential fields so candidates can apply in seconds—remember, forty-six percent have walked away when a login was required. Optimize for mobile since applicants rely heavily on phones to apply, and make the experience thumb-friendly from start to finish. Deploy QR codes on-site, at events, and in service lounges to capture walk-in interest at the exact moment someone is curious enough to explore a role.

3. Win The “Digital First Impression”

Upgrade your branded career site with clear pay ranges, transparent growth paths, and authentic team stories—this is the top channel candidates use to evaluate you (37%). Spotlight what actually tips decisions when offers are similar: flexible scheduling and extra PTO. Feature employee testimonials and referral spotlights, the second-most trusted signal for culture, so prospects can picture themselves on your team.

4. Personalize, Then Persist

Use text and email updates at every stage; silence feels like a “no,” even when you’re still reviewing. Acknowledge and tailor messages to the two key audiences you see in your pipeline: 49% of applicants are new to auto while 34% are industry veterans—speak to training, mentorship, and certifications for newcomers, and to growth, advanced tools, and leadership paths for pros.

5. Put Visibility and Compliance on Rails

Track each step—from application to offer—to spot bottlenecks and hold managers accountable for response times. Run integrated background checks to keep the process safe and fast rather than bolted on at the end, preventing last-mile delays that frustrate candidates and stall your start dates.

Seven Day Hiring Playbook 

Day 0–1: Publish mobile-first postings, no logins; enable QR applications
Launch postings that a candidate can complete in under two minutes on a phone. Put QR codes at service desks, on showroom signage, and on business cards so curious customers and walk-ins can convert on the spot.

Day 1–2: Same-day screen; automated interview scheduling; share links to your branded career site and team testimonials
Review every new resume the day it arrives and follow up within 24 hours. Use automated interview scheduling to offer multiple time slots instantly, and include links to your branded career site and real employee stories to build excitement between steps.

Day 3–4: Conduct structured interviews; text updates between steps; prep conditional offers
Run structured interviews to compare candidates fairly and quickly. Keep momentum with brief text updates after each interview, and have conditional offer templates ready so you can move immediately once you’ve aligned on a finalist.

Day 5–7: Background and compliance checks in-platform; final offer with clear pay, schedule flexibility, PTO, and growth path
Initiate integrated checks the same day, then deliver a final offer that spells out compensation, schedule flexibility, PTO, and the growth path you discussed—so candidates can say “yes” without hunting for details.

Speed is Respect

It shows candidates you run a tight operation, value their time, and can make decisions. In a market where applicants expect interviews within four days, apply on their phones, and rarely accept the first offer, the dealers who remove friction and move decisively will win the best people—consistently. Build for speed, communicate like you mean it, and you’ll keep bays full, customers happy, and your hiring brand a step ahead.
